Charles A. Arigo, 49, of 8663 Bruton Parish Court, Manassas, Va., died Friday Feb. 13, 1998 at St. Elizabeth Medical Center, Granite City, Ill. Born June 21, 1948 in Hanover, he was the son of Charles N and Jean M. Conrad Arigo of Hanover. He was married to Diane Staub Arigo of Manassas.
He was Deputy Auditor General for the U.S. Army Audit Agency. He was a former member of Annunciation Catholic Church in McSherrystown.
In addition to his wife, he is survived bu a daughter, Trina Arigo Gallagher of Manassas, Va., a son Richard Arigo of Charlottesville, Va., a brother, Phillip Arigo of Hanover; and three sisters, Margaret Steinour of Gettysburg; Paula Myers and Mary Beth Brooks, both of Hanover. He was predeceased by two brothers, Richard J. Arigo and Jeffrey P. Arigo.
Funeral services will be held Tuesday, Feb. 17, meeting at Hicks Funeral Home, McSherrystown, at 9:30 a.m. followed bu a Mass of Christian Burial at Annunciation Catholic Church at 10 a.m. with Rev. Andre J. Meluskey officiating. Interment will be in Annunciation Cemetery, McSherrystown.

Obit in the Gettysburg Times, Monday, Feb. 16, 1998.
